1. Snap, save, and create: Transforming memories into content

Your phone's camera roll is a treasure trove of memories waiting to be transformed into engaging content. Take advantage of those peaceful naptime moments to browse through your photos and videos. Favourite the best ones and brainstorm how you can use them for your business. Can they be static posts? Are they reel-worthy material, or better suited for Stories? Organise them into albums on your phone for quick access when inspiration strikes.

Pro tip: Use your phone's downtime to brainstorm captions and hashtags to go along with your visuals. You'll thank yourself later when you're in a rush to post.

2. Reel it in: Edit and share like a pro


Ever found yourself with a surplus of video footage but not quite sure how to turn it into a captivating reel? Instagram now offers a lifesaver in the form of templates for trending sounds. Just drag and drop your clips, add some flair, and voilà – you've got a reel ready to go. Got some stellar photos that need a little touch-up? Numerous user-friendly apps can help you fine-tune your images. You can also check out Canva's new features, including background removal and instant product placement layouts for added pizzazz.

Pro tip: Experiment with different editing styles to give your content a unique and eye-catching aesthetic.

3. Stay on beat: Discover trending social media sounds


While your baby snoozes, it's the perfect opportunity to scour social media for the latest trending sounds. Don’t forget to turn the volume down, you wouldn't want to wake the little one with a sudden burst of loud music! Save these sounds for your next reel creation.

Pro tip: Stay ahead of the game by regularly checking out what's trending in your niche. Trending sounds can vary widely across different industries so keep it relevant to your business.

4. Connect and engage: Be a social butterfly


Engaging with your online community is crucial for building a loyal following. During those quiet moments, reply to comments on your posts, tackle your DMs, and consider commenting or reacting to your followers' stories. Feeling bold? Slide into someone else's DMs and introduce your fantastic products or services. You never know where a friendly conversation might lead.

Pro tip: Authenticity is key in social interactions. Be yourself, and people will appreciate your genuine approach.

5. Time is of the essence: Schedule it all


As a mumpreneur, time is your most valuable asset. To stay on top of your social media game without losing precious moments, use scheduling tools to plan your posts in advance. This strategy ensures a consistent online presence, even during those hectic mum moments.

Pro tip: Experiment with different posting times to see when your audience is most active and engaged. You can also check your dashboard for insights and see when your audience is most active.
